Subject: Handover — breaker state DB

Hey Priya,

Before you review my branch: the circuit breaker for the Quillhook upstream API persists trip state so restarts don't reset the cooldown. Half-open probes run every 30s, and the state table is tiny — one row per endpoint. The migration in the PR adds a last_probe column. To poke at the state table locally, connect with the string below.

Cheers, Dov

primary connection of tajeg-tajop = postgresql://julax_svc:DI@db-e7f3.kelvidyn.corp:5432/rusdor

Notes from the Tuesday sync — flagging this for the security review. The MedPing reminder job pulls tomorrow's appointments at 6am and fires SMS/email notifications. We trimmed the payload so messages only say time and clinic, no visit reason. Access to the patient table is now read-only via a scoped service account. Retention on job logs is 30 days. Questions on the threat model go to the owner.

account owner for bawip-tahag: Raleth Quenok

Welcome to the PotScale review. PotScale is our recipe-scaling calculator: users enter a base recipe and a target yield, and the service recomputes quantities, converts units, and rounds to practical measures. Input parsing happens in the quantity-parser module; that's where most injection risk lives. Scaling math runs server-side in the Ladleworks cluster with no persistence beyond a short cache. Threat model drafts and prior review notes from the Fenwick audit are collected on the internal page below.

wiki page, bagaf-fawip: https://harbor.tolvaqsys.local/pages/repo/pages/secrets/eac969ffc71f356b

Ticket: EVSCH-77. The Ledgerline schema registry rejected all event publishes overnight because the writer credential expired. Producers fell back to local buffering, so no data loss, but the buffer drains slowly. Reviewer: please confirm the patch swaps the expired secret for the new one in the registry client config and adds an expiry alert at T-14 days. The replacement key for the internal registry service is below.

service key, fawip-bajef: kto11_Qt5wZK9vdNC